Fried Calamari

Fried Calamari - deep fried calamari recipe, Italian style. Serve with tomato sauce as dipping sauce, this is the best recipe ever, extra crispy, easy and delicious!

Ingredients

  • 8-12 oz (230g-350g) squid and tentacles cleaned
  • 1 large egg beaten
  • 4 oz (125g) all-purpose flour
  • 2 oz (60g) cornstarch
  • 1/8 teaspoon salt
  • 3 dashes cayenne pepper
  • oil for deep drying
  • bottled tomato sauce or pasta sauce, for dipping
  • chopped parsley for garnishing

Instructions

  1. Cut the cleaned squid tubes into 1/2-inch (1 cm) rings.
  2. Transfer the squid rings to a large bowl, add a beaten egg, and stir to coat evenly.
  3. In a separate large bowl, combine the all-purpose flour, cornstarch, salt, and cayenne pepper. Stir until well mixed. Working in small batches, add a few squid rings to the flour mixture, ensuring they are thoroughly coated, then transfer them to a strainer. Repeat until all the squid rings are coated. Gently shake the strainer to remove any excess flour.
  4. Heat a skillet with 1 inch (2.5 cm) of oil over high heat. Once the oil is hot, deep-fry the squid until they turn light brown. Remove the squid from the oil and drain on paper towels.
  5. Garnish the squid with parsley and serve warm with tomato sauce.
